Jean-Paul Satre - Christine Daigle
ISBN/ISSN: 041543565X
Introducing both literary and philosophical texts by Sartre, this volume makes Sartre’s ideas newly accessible to students of literary and cultural studies as well as to students of continental philosophy and French. Christine Daigle sets Sartre’s thought in context, and considers a number of key ideas in detail, charting their impact and continuing influence, including:
Sartre’s theories of consciousness, being and freedom; the ethics of authenticity and absolute responsibility; concrete relations, sexual relationships and gender difference;
the social and political role of the author;
the legacy of Sartre’s theories and their relationship to structuralism and philosophy of mind. (from Amazon product details)
